恭喜上海沄熹科技有限公司梁波獲國家專利權
買專利賣專利找龍圖騰,真高效! 查專利查商標用IPTOP,全免費!專利年費監控用IP管家,真方便!
龍圖騰網恭喜上海沄熹科技有限公司申請的專利時序數據存儲引擎的亂序處理方法及系統獲國家發明授權專利權,本發明授權專利權由國家知識產權局授予,授權公告號為:CN116166715B 。
龍圖騰網通過國家知識產權局官網在2025-05-23發布的發明授權授權公告中獲悉:該發明授權的專利申請號/專利號為:202310096745.1,技術領域涉及:G06F16/2458;該發明授權時序數據存儲引擎的亂序處理方法及系統是由梁波;于暄;賈德星;張煒剛設計研發完成,并于2023-02-07向國家知識產權局提交的專利申請。
本時序數據存儲引擎的亂序處理方法及系統在說明書摘要公布了:本發明公開了時序數據存儲引擎的亂序處理方法及系統,屬于時序數據庫技術領域,要解決的技術問題為如何在存儲和使用亂序數據的同時、保證存儲引擎的性能。包括如下步驟:在內存區中配置有多個不同ZdataPoint對象,每個ZdataPoint對象中包含有多個ZBlock;在內存區分配固定大小的連續內存區作為緩存,在緩存內劃分有時序內存塊和亂序內存塊,并在時序內存塊中預留順序空間及亂序空間;申請一個ZBlock、通過所述ZBlock將時序數據寫入與所述ZBlock對應的時序內存塊;對于處于已寫滿狀態的ZBlock,通過落盤線程將時序數據落盤至磁盤區,落盤成功后,在文件索引部追加所述時序數據的信息記錄。
本發明授權時序數據存儲引擎的亂序處理方法及系統在權利要求書中公布了:1.一種時序數據存儲引擎的亂序處理方法,其特征在于,所述存儲引擎內包括內存區和磁盤區,所述時序數據包括順序數據和亂序數據,所述方法包括如下步驟:在內存區中配置有多個不同ZdataPoint對象,每個ZdataPoint對象中包含有多個ZBlock,每個ZBlock用于調控一段時間內時序數據的存儲,ZBlock之間對應的時間段沒有交叉;在內存區分配固定大小的連續內存區作為緩存,在緩存內劃分有用于存儲時序數據的時序內存塊和用于存儲亂序數據的亂序內存塊,所述時序內存塊的內存空間大于所述亂序內存塊的內存空間,并基于亂序數據概率、在時序內存塊中預留用于存放順序數據的順序空間以及用于存放亂序數據的亂序空間;對于采集點采集的時序數據,基于采集點來源將時序數據劃分至對應的ZdataPoint對象中,申請一個ZBlock、通過所述ZBlock將時序數據寫入與所述ZBlock對應的時序內存塊;對于處于已寫滿狀態的ZBlock,通過落盤線程將所述ZBlock對應時序內存塊中的時序數據落盤至磁盤區,落盤成功后,在文件索引部追加所述時序數據的信息記錄;其中,申請一個ZBlock、通過ZBlock將時序數據寫入時序內存塊,遵循如下原則:將順序數據寫入順序空間,將亂序數據寫入亂序空間;如果當前亂序空間已寫滿,新產生的亂序數據為當前ZBlock對應時間段內的,通過ZBlock申請一個亂序內存塊,將新產生的亂序數據寫入所述亂序內存塊;如果當前順序空間已寫滿,申請一個新的ZBlock、通過所述新的ZBlock將時序數據寫入與所述新的ZBlock對應的新的時序內存塊;如果當前緩存已寫滿,基于預配置的緩存回收機制,回收預定數量的ZBlock,通過回收預定數量的ZBlock,刪除所述ZBlock、并釋放對應的時序內存塊。
如需購買、轉讓、實施、許可或投資類似專利技術,可聯系本專利的申請人或專利權人上海沄熹科技有限公司,其通訊地址為:200120 上海市浦東新區中國(上海)自由貿易試驗區張東路1158號、丹桂路1059號2幢305-22室;或者聯系龍圖騰網官方客服,聯系龍圖騰網可撥打電話0551-65771310或微信搜索“龍圖騰網”。
1、本報告根據公開、合法渠道獲得相關數據和信息,力求客觀、公正,但并不保證數據的最終完整性和準確性。
2、報告中的分析和結論僅反映本公司于發布本報告當日的職業理解,僅供參考使用,不能作為本公司承擔任何法律責任的依據或者憑證。